Calculatedly

/ˈkælkjʊˌleɪtɪdli/ adverb

Definition

In a deliberate, planned manner that has been carefully thought out; intentionally and with forethought.

Etymology

From calculated (past participle of calculate) plus the adverbial suffix -ly. The word suggests actions done with careful consideration rather than improvisation.

Kelly Says

When something is done 'calculatedly,' it implies strategy and intentionality—like a chess player's calculated moves. Interestingly, the word is more common in descriptions of human behavior than in math contexts.
